South Albany has gone a perfect 7-0 against McKay recently and they'll look to pad the win column further on Friday. The South Albany Redhawks will welcome the McKay Royal Scots at 5:30 p.m. The teams are on pretty different trajectories at the moment (South Albany has nine straight victories, McKay has six straight losses), but none of that matters once you're on the court.
Last Tuesday, South Albany got the win against West Albany by a conclusive 63-40. The Redhawks have made a habit of sweeping their opponents off the court, having now won six games by 23 points or more this season.
Meanwhile, it's never fun to lose, and it's even less fun to lose 53-23, which was the final score in McKay's tilt against Crescent Valley on Tuesday. While losing is never fun, the Royal Scots can't take it too hard given the team's big disadvantage in MaxPreps' Oregon basketball rankings (they are ranked 216th, while the Raiders are ranked 78th).
South Albany's win was their tenth straight at home dating back to last season, which pushed their record up to 14-4. Those victories came thanks in part to their offensive performance across that stretch, as they averaged 60.4 points over those games. As for McKay, their defeat dropped their record down to 2-16.
Everything came up roses for South Albany against McKay in their previous meeting back in January, as the team secured a 77-9 victory. Will South Albany repeat their success, or does McKay have a new game plan this time around? We'll find out soon enough.
